Johnson Brothers Friendly Village has been a household favorite since its introduction in 1953. This timeless dinnerware pattern features charming pastoral scenes, snow-covered cottages, rustic mills, and country landscapes that capture the beauty of an English village. Each piece seamlessly blends rich transferware detail with subtle, hand-applied colors, creating a warm, nostalgic look that is perfect for both everyday dining and special occasions.
Crafted in durable earthenware, Johnson Brothers Friendly Village dishes are known for their practicality as well as their beauty. Families have passed down sets for generations, making this pattern a staple of holiday tables and cherished collections. Though production has shifted over the years, Johnson Brothers China Friendly Village remains highly sought after by collectors eager to complete or expand their tableware sets.
Johnson Brothers Friendly Village Pattern Styles
The Friendly Village collection features a variety of pastoral scenes, each with its own distinctive charm:
- The Well – A spring countryside scene with a rustic stone well, blossoming trees, and a red-roofed cottage.
- Stone Wall – A peaceful orchard setting with a stone fence, leafy trees, and a cottage in the distance.
- Hayfield – An open farmland view with a wooden fence, rolling fields, and a distant red barn under cloudy skies.
- Old Mill – A rustic red mill reflected in a quiet pond, surrounded by trees and lush greenery.
- Autumn Mists – A red mill and bare autumn trees set in a foggy seasonal landscape.
- Lily Pond – A tranquil red mill by a water’s edge, with lily pads and reflections across the pond.
- The Willow – Graceful willow trees frame a countryside view of a mill and rustic home along a stream.
- School House – A red schoolhouse and snowy village scene, evoking winter nostalgia.
- Village Green – A church and cottages surrounded by blossoming spring trees and hills.
- Covered Bridge – The most iconic design, with a red covered bridge set in a snowy woodland landscape.
- Sugar Maples – Maple trees tapped for sap with a barn in the background, capturing sugaring season.
- Harvest Time – A broad farm scene with a large tree, open fields, and red barns ready for harvest.
